In a candid, data-driven conversation, Professor Bob Loevy shares insights on how the ballot initiative allowing unaffiliated voters to participate in primaries has shifted political engagement—and why the rise of fringe candidates like Marx and Bottoms signals a deeper systemic crisis. You'll discover how party registration impacts political influence, why moderates are left out of the process, and the insidious ways extreme views are hijacking both parties. Loevy breaks down the role of the caucus system, petition-based nominations, and the urgent need for reform—like electing party officials at large—to restore balance.
